Developing Your Unique Sound

  

Developing Your Unique Sound

Developing your unique sound is a crucial aspect of music production and audio engineering. It involves creating a distinctive auditory identity that sets an artist apart from others in the industry. This article explores various techniques, tools, and concepts that can help musicians and producers cultivate their unique sound.

Understanding Your Influences

Before you can develop your unique sound, it is essential to understand the influences that shape your musical style. This can include:

  • Genres: Identify the genres that resonate with you, such as rock, jazz, hip hop, etc.
  • Artists: Analyze the work of artists you admire and note the elements that contribute to their sound.
  • Instruments: Consider the instruments you are drawn to and how they can shape your music.

Experimenting with Sound Design

Sound design plays a pivotal role in developing a unique sound. It involves manipulating audio to create new and interesting sonic textures. Here are some key aspects to consider:

Technique Description Tools
Synthesis Creating sounds using synthesizers, which can be analog or digital. Software Synths, Hardware Synths
Sampling Using snippets of audio from other recordings to create new sounds. Sample Packs, DAWs
Effects Processing Applying effects such as reverb, delay, and distortion to alter sound. Plugins, Hardware Processors

Building Your Production Skills

To develop your unique sound, it is essential to build strong production skills. Here are some key areas to focus on:

  • Mixing: The process of blending different audio tracks to create a cohesive sound.
  • Mastering: The final step in audio production, ensuring the track sounds polished and professional.
  • Arrangement: Structuring your song to enhance its flow and impact.

Creating a Signature Style

Your signature style is the culmination of your influences, sound design, and production skills. Here are ways to develop it:

  • Consistency: Maintain a consistent approach to your music, whether through instrumentation, lyrical themes, or production techniques.
  • Innovation: Don't be afraid to break the mold. Experiment with unconventional sounds and structures.
  • Feedback: Seek constructive criticism from peers and mentors to refine your sound.

Utilizing Technology

Technology plays a significant role in modern music production. Some tools to consider include:

Tool Purpose Examples
Digital Audio Workstation (DAW) Software for recording, editing, and producing audio. Logic Pro, Ableton Live, FL Studio
Plugins Software add-ons that provide additional sounds and effects. Waves, Native Instruments, FabFilter
Audio Interfaces Hardware that connects instruments and microphones to a computer. Focusrite Scarlett, PreSonus AudioBox

Collaborating with Other Artists

Collaboration can lead to new ideas and perspectives, helping to refine your unique sound. Consider the following:

  • Work with musicians from different genres to blend styles.
  • Engage with producers and sound engineers to learn new techniques.
  • Participate in jam sessions or songwriting workshops to inspire creativity.

Practicing and Refining Your Sound

The development of a unique sound is an ongoing process. Here are some tips for continual improvement:

  • Regular Practice: Dedicate time to experiment with new sounds and techniques regularly.
  • Record Everything: Capture ideas as they come, even if they seem incomplete.
  • Stay Informed: Keep up with trends in music production and audio engineering through online courses and tutorials.
